Why do we study civics?

We study civics to understand the principles and functions of government, our rights and responsibilities as citizens, and the importance of civic engagement in a democratic society. This knowledge empowers individuals to participate meaningfully in political processes, advocate for their communities, and uphold democratic values. Additionally, civics education fosters critical thinking and informed decision-making, essential for navigating complex social and political issues. Ultimately, it cultivates active and responsible citizenship.
